Re: 10/20 400+bb Deep with KK
As i said having that in mind i would be more inclined to call, although that min reraise really smells like aces. But as another poster said there is a lot of money in the pot, and you have the second nuts. Its really a tough spot but i would at the end say call (all in)
I dont know how big a donkey SB was, but the way he played the hand i think it is safe to assume he has ak or aq. I cant imagine even the bigger donks these days calling their chips off (200bb's) at high stakes with anything less (poosibly tt or 99 also) That information can make t easier to push given that it is that much less likely that villain has aa, although at the end it can still happen. |

Re: 10/20 400+bb Deep with KK
I keep thinking with card removal you should shove since I would think the fish has an ace making AA less likely than QQ, and I think his line is consistent with both. The fish though could be way out of line so who knows. It is a really tricky spot, especially if the small blind would fold QQ to a shove.
